Who are you, exactly?
An independent travel advisor, affiliated with Fora Travel. Fora is the host agency — it provides the booking platform and the preferred partner programmes; I do the planning and look after your trip. You deal with one person throughout.
What rates and perks can you book?
Through Fora I have access to preferred partner programmes — Virtuoso, Four Seasons Preferred Partner, Rosewood Elite and others — which typically add daily breakfast, a hotel or spa credit, an upgrade where available, and flexible check-in or check-out. The room rate is usually the same as booking direct; the benefits come on top.
What does it cost?
Hotel-only bookings are complimentary — the hotel pays a commission for the introduction, and your rate stays the same. For fuller itineraries involving flights, ground arrangements or multi-stop planning, I'll be upfront about any planning fee before we start.
Do you only book hotels?
No — I also plan full trips. Where it makes the trip better, I work with vetted local travel agencies and operators on the ground for tours, drivers and experiences, so you get local knowledge rather than a generic package.
Can I pay with my own credit card?
Yes, absolutely. Bookings are charged to your own card — usually directly by the hotel or provider — so you keep your card's points, protections and benefits. In some cases the provider may ask for an extra layer of identity verification, such as a card authorisation form; I'll walk you through it if that happens.
Am I locked in once I enquire?
Not at all. The first chat is just that — a chat. I'll come back with ideas and rates, and nothing is booked until you say so.
